“…The authors showed an energy-transfer cascade from the excited dyes in the ZL channels to the ZnPc acceptor through a stopcock molecule. [12] However, Pcs have been explored as stopcock molecules only very recently. [13] Unsymmetrically substituted ZnPcs bearing a rigid tail substituent at one of the isoindole units are unique examples of two-dimensional stopcock molecules that provide an ideal electronic dipole moment coupling situation independent of the orientation of the dyes in the ZL channels.…”
